At the 2023 Ghana School on Internet Governance (GhanaSIG) Fellowship organized by EGIGFA, one of the most cherished moments was the "Time with GhanaSIG Fellows" session. During this enlightening encounter, our current fellows had the privilege of engaging with the following past years fellows, who generously shared their experiences and successes in the Internet Governance space: ABRAHAM FIIFI SELBY, Frank Anati, Jessica Dadzie, Ben Rachad Sanoussi, Lavish Mawuena Mensah, Prince Andrew Livingstone Zutah.
